What is The Jury Experience?
An immersive courtroom drama where you become part of the story as a juror. Analyze testimonies, cross-examinations, and evidence to uncover the truth. Your vote determines the accused's fate.
How long does it last?
Approximately 1 hour.
Are seats numbered?
No — first-come, first-served within the zone you select. Zone A = best, B = great, C = good. Wheelchair accessible (ADA) tickets also available.
Is there sensitive content I should be aware of?
Yes — this show contains themes of domestic violence, emotional manipulation, alcohol use, and a distressing 911 call. Parental discretion is advised.
Can I purchase drinks on-site?
Yes — there is an on-site bar serving beverages. Food is not available for purchase on-site.
Will there be strobe lights?
No.

Where is the venue?
Ybor City Performing Arts Building (YPAB), 1411 E 11th Ave, Tampa, FL 33605. Indoor venue.
When should I arrive?
Doors open 30 minutes before the start. No late entry.
Is there an age requirement?
12+. Anyone under 16 must be accompanied by an adult.
Is the venue wheelchair accessible?
Yes, the venue is ADA compliant. Dedicated wheelchair accessible (ADA) tickets are available.
Is there parking?
Yes, parking is available on-site.
What facilities are at the venue?
Restrooms on-site, cleaned regularly. Air conditioning. No outside food or beverages. No smoking or vaping. Service animals welcome.
